Q1 2026 revenue grew 69% YoY, operating margin 27.6%, EPS $1.01; but user growth decelerated to 17% and 94% of revenue is advertising dependent on Google. Author states the investment case hinges on sustained ARPU expansion, not AI licensing, and valuation remains rich. No clear buy or sell signal, but the structural risk from Google and decelerating DAUq make the stock a watch candidate. The data supports monitoring Reddit for signs of ARPU growth durability or a pullback to a more attractive valuation. Current price (~$175) is fairly priced for the bull case but vulnerable to disappointment. User growth could decelerate further; Google algorithm changes or AI Overviews could reduce traffic; ad spending slowdown; AI licensing revenue fails to scale.
